S.A.F.E Tip #1… Drum Roll Please!!!!!!!! S.A.F.E. Room
A very inexpensive way to add a SAFE room to your home is to upgrade your master bedroom bath door to a fire-rated door, and install a dead bolt. This will give you time to escape through a window, or remain safe behind an impenetrable door,
Have a contingency family escape plan in place; having a landline/cell phone there can also be a plus.
Stay S.A.F.E Survey Avoid Flee Engage
